Federer vs Murray
ATPWorldTour.com reviews how the key rivalries played out in 2012. Today we feature Roger Federer vs. Andy Murray.
In 2012, Andy Murray was on a mission. Very few players have winning head-to-heads against arguably the greatest player of all time, Roger Federer. Murray is one such individual, who could boast an 8-6 advantage over Federer going into the 2012 season. However, while he may have recorded some notable wins over the Swiss, including in the finals of the 2010 Rogers Cup and Shanghai Rolex Masters, the Scot was yet to topple Federer in a best-of-five set encounter.
In the two Grand Slam finals they had contested, at the 2008 US Open and the 2010 Australian Open, it was Federer who had always prevailed without the loss of a set. With new coach Ivan Lendl in his corner, could Murray change that this season against a Federer who some claimed was beginning to fade at the age of 30? They had not played since the 2010 Barclays ATP World Tour Finals, remarkably not crossing paths in 2011.
